i pick this knife up at walmart at a closeout sale that i couldnt pass up. its a very sturdy and well built knife, but i cant get over the fact the the serrations seem to cover a majority of the blade... i do like how the blade is quite thick and stands up to tuff use.

I bought the 650 first and like it, but wanted something a little smaller. So I purchased a 655 plain edge and love it. It's heavier than my SOG Seal Pup Elite, but the 655's full tang is quite thick which adds to the weight as well as thickness of the blade. I'm not the type to stick the tip into concrete and see how much pressure it can take, but this blade has stood up to some yard work, hacking, splitting and more. It still looks brand new.

Besides the awesome blade, the GRIP is the true seller for me. It doesn't mar up easily and provides a great handle to hold on to. My hands are normal sized and the handle of this knife fits very well. Most knives have much smaller handles and the smaller handles look a lot "cooler" but when you start using the knife, you realize the small handle makes it very hard to hold onto.

The sheath does its job, but is in no way tactical. The sheath is the same sheath the 650 uses, so there is about an inch and a half of empty space in it at the bottom. I would like the sheath to by kydex and only as long as needed. I may end up making my own.

The price for this knife is crazy low. When I purchased the knife, I figured it would be a throw away after a while, but was pleasantly surprised to see that this is now one of my favorite knives in my collection.
